Salsa Fresca

Salsa Fresca is a vibrant, fresh salsa made from ripe tomatoes, crisp onions, and zesty lime, perfect for dipping or topping. This healthy American snack is packed with flavor and nutrients, making it a great choice for any gathering.

Ingredients

  • Ripe tomatoes - 250 grams, diced
  • Red onion - 50 grams, finely chopped
  • Fresh cilantro - 15 grams, chopped
  • Jalapeño pepper - 1 small, minced (adjust for spice preference)
  • Lime - 1, juiced
  • Salt - 1/2 teaspoon
  • Black pepper - 1/4 teaspoon

Steps

  1. Start by dicing the ripe tomatoes and finely chopping the red onion.
  2. In a mixing bowl, combine the diced tomatoes and chopped red onion.
  3. Add the minced jalapeño pepper, chopped cilantro, lime juice, salt, and black pepper to the bowl.
  4. Gently toss all the ingredients together until well combined.
  5. Taste and adjust seasoning if necessary, adding more salt or lime juice to your preference.
  6. Let the salsa sit for about 10 minutes to allow the flavors to meld before serving.
